In a rare public appearance on her own, former First Lady Melania Trump took center stage at the International Women of Courage Awards, hinting at a new chapter where she steps out of her husband Donald Trump’s shadow and defines her own voice.
Delivering an emotional speech, Melania focused on love as a powerful force in the face of hardship. She spoke about how love helped guide her through difficult times, calling it a source of empathy, forgiveness, and courage. She honored the award recipients—women who have put their lives at risk to defend human rights—as powerful examples of strength rooted in compassion.
This solo appearance reflects what insiders say is Melania’s growing desire to carve out her own identity beyond the traditional expectations of a First Lady. Her story will be further explored in an upcoming Amazon documentary, set to release in late 2025, tracing her path from her roots in Slovenia to her time in the White House. She’s also taking a behind-the-scenes role as an executive producer, working alongside Fernando Sulichin and Brett Ratner.
